Email — Raw Multi-Recipient

Raw multi-recipient email extension for Caffeine AI.

Overview

This skill adds support for sending emails with multiple to, cc, and bcc recipients. Not suitable for bulk service emails (recipients see each other).

Backend

This extension is for sending an email with support for multiple to, cc and bcc addresses.

  • This should NOT be used for sending service emails to multiple users because each recipient will see all the other recipients listed which would typically be a breach of user privacy.

For sending an email

  • This extension depends on the extension-email for sending emails.
  • Use the sendRawEmail function.
  • It returns a SendResult which is #ok if the email is sent successfully otherwise #err(error) with the error text.
  • There can be a maximum of 50 recipients in total
  • Each recipient receives the same email
module {
  public type SendResult = {
    #ok;
    #err : Text;
  };

  public func sendRawEmail(
    fromUsername : Text,
    to : [Text],
    cc : [Text],
    bcc : [Text],
    subject : Text,
    htmlBody : Text,
  ) : async SendResult;
};

Example usage for sending an email reminder to meeting attendees.

import Runtime "mo:core/Runtime";
import EmailClient "mo:caffeineai-email/emailClient";

actor {
  public func sendMeetingReminder(
    meetingSubject : Text,
    meetingTime : Text,
    confirmedAttendeeEmails : [Text],
    tentativeAttendeeEmails : [Text],
  ) : async () {
    let result = await EmailClient.sendRawEmail(
      "no-reply",
      confirmedAttendeeEmails,
      tentativeAttendeeEmails,
      [],
      meetingSubject,
      "Reminder the meeting will start at " # meetingTime,
    );

    switch (result) {
      case (#ok) {};
      case (#err(error)) {
        Runtime.trap("Failed to send meeting reminder email: " # error);
      };
    };
  };
};
